Default Macro 2 Extract Data 2 Paste in New Wksht


undefined

Each morning a spreadsheet is sent to various regional managers - The
person who generates this just creates another row - It is sorted by
date - and separated by an empty row.

So I may have two rows with column "A" as a date, "B" as a problem, "C"
as something else, "D" as a region...etc. Then a blank or empty row,
then the yesterday's section..there may have been 3 or 4 rows of
data...and so on...

So...what I have been doing manually is to search for the empty rows
and delete all but the last one...

Then I do an AutoFilter...

Then I sort Column "D" - Region - one region at a time ( I am
responsible for 15 or so ) once it's sorted for a specific region - I
select the entire series of rows pertaining to that region and copy and
paste to a separate worksheet in the same workbook for that region.

I wasn't sure where to start...I was trying to create a macro...one at
a time and then maybe I could put them altogether...and create one
complete macro...first to eliminate those empty rows..all but the last
one...

I would really appreciate any assistance anyone could offer...
